Nets Intend To Hire Jordi Fernandez As Head Coach

HoopsRumors (Alex Kirschenbaum) — Kings assistant coach Jordi Fernandez is set to become the Nets‘ pick for their head coach ahead of the 2024/25 NBA season, sources inform Adrian Wojnarowski of ESPN (Twitter link). Woj notes that Fernandez became Brooklyn’s preferred candidate following an exhaustively thorough search over the last month. More to come…

Cronin: Blazers Committed To Billups As Head Coach

HoopsRumors (Luke Adams) — Speaking today to reporters, Trail Blazers general manager Joe Cronin confirmed that the team is committed to Chauncey Billups as its head coach and indicated that the plan is to have Billups return for the 2024/25 season (Twitter links via Sean Highkin of Rose Garden Report and Bill Oram of The Oregonian). Pistons To Seek President Of Basketball Operations

HoopsRumors (Luke Adams) — The Pistons have decided they will hire a president of basketball operations, according to Shams Charania of The Athletic, who reports (via Twitter) that the search process will begin this week. Nikola Jokic, Jalen Brunson Named Players Of The Week

HoopsRumors (Luke Adams) — Nuggets center Nikola Jokic has been named the Western Conference’s final Player of the Week for the 2023/24 season, while Knicks guard Jalen Brunson has won the award for the Eastern Conference, the NBA announced today (via Twitter).
